The history of personal computing

Cycling as urban transportation

Effective methods for learning foreign languages

Urban planning challenges

Micro-mobility solutions

Artificial intelligence applications in everyday life

Ethical considerations in technology

Ocean cleanup technologies

Climate change and individual responsibility